2026-03-07 18:53:08.690532 | Job console starting 2026-03-07 18:53:08.702207 | Updating git repos 2026-03-07 18:53:08.724224 | Cloning repos into workspace 2026-03-07 18:53:08.790041 | Restoring repo states 2026-03-07 18:53:08.798725 | Merging changes 2026-03-07 18:53:08.798753 | Checking out repos 2026-03-07 18:53:08.852826 | Preparing playbooks 2026-03-07 18:53:09.549607 | Running Ansible setup 2026-03-07 18:53:15.147439 | PRE-RUN START: [trusted : github.com/osism/zuul-config/playbooks/base/pre.yaml@main] 2026-03-07 18:53:15.926447 | 2026-03-07 18:53:15.926602 | PLAY [Base pre] 2026-03-07 18:53:15.943503 | 2026-03-07 18:53:15.943632 | TASK [Setup log path fact] 2026-03-07 18:53:15.973495 | noble | ok 2026-03-07 18:53:15.991094 | 2026-03-07 18:53:15.991230 | TASK [set-zuul-log-path-fact : Set log path for a build] 2026-03-07 18:53:16.032737 | noble | ok 2026-03-07 18:53:16.045049 | 2026-03-07 18:53:16.045166 | TASK [emit-job-header : Print job information] 2026-03-07 18:53:16.093461 | # Job Information 2026-03-07 18:53:16.093734 | Ansible Version: 2.16.14 2026-03-07 18:53:16.093796 | Job: openstack-ironic-images-publish-osism-ipa 2026-03-07 18:53:16.093853 | Pipeline: post 2026-03-07 18:53:16.093894 | Executor: 521e9411259a 2026-03-07 18:53:16.093931 | Triggered by: https://github.com/osism/openstack-ironic-images/commit/c084f8130aad629fd92503db59675a82b3fa5f83 2026-03-07 18:53:16.093970 | Event ID: 83b348ea-1a56-11f1-8d27-ca23384c9287 2026-03-07 18:53:16.106686 | 2026-03-07 18:53:16.106879 | LOOP [emit-job-header : Print node information] 2026-03-07 18:53:16.238262 | noble | ok: 2026-03-07 18:53:16.238557 | noble | # Node Information 2026-03-07 18:53:16.238614 | noble | Inventory Hostname: noble 2026-03-07 18:53:16.238657 | noble | Hostname: ubuntu 2026-03-07 18:53:16.238694 | noble | Username: zuul 2026-03-07 18:53:16.238728 | noble | Distro: Ubuntu 24.04 2026-03-07 18:53:16.238767 | noble | Provider: regiocloud-a 2026-03-07 18:53:16.238802 | noble | Region: 2026-03-07 18:53:16.238874 | noble | Label: ubuntu-noble-uefi 2026-03-07 18:53:16.238913 | noble | Product Name: OpenStack Nova 2026-03-07 18:53:16.238946 | noble | Interface IP: 2a13:1a81:8000:3124:f816:3eff:feb9:3e92 2026-03-07 18:53:16.267175 | 2026-03-07 18:53:16.267315 | TASK [log-inventory : Ensure Zuul Ansible directory exists] 2026-03-07 18:53:16.779854 | noble -> localhost | changed 2026-03-07 18:53:16.797667 | 2026-03-07 18:53:16.797837 | TASK [log-inventory : Copy ansible inventory to logs dir] 2026-03-07 18:53:17.907841 | noble -> localhost | changed 2026-03-07 18:53:17.930824 | 2026-03-07 18:53:17.930978 | TASK [add-build-sshkey : Check to see if ssh key was already created for this build] 2026-03-07 18:53:18.210802 | noble -> localhost | ok 2026-03-07 18:53:18.221823 | 2026-03-07 18:53:18.221998 | TASK [add-build-sshkey : Create a new key in workspace based on build UUID] 2026-03-07 18:53:18.254509 | noble | ok 2026-03-07 18:53:18.272227 | noble | included: /var/lib/zuul/builds/6b4b4a7956ab4e938423213f455e42e2/trusted/project_1/github.com/osism/openinfra-zuul-jobs/roles/add-build-sshkey/tasks/create-key-and-replace.yaml 2026-03-07 18:53:18.280627 | 2026-03-07 18:53:18.280743 | TASK [add-build-sshkey : Create Temp SSH key] 2026-03-07 18:53:20.032843 | noble -> localhost | Generating public/private rsa key pair. 2026-03-07 18:53:20.033134 | noble -> localhost | Your identification has been saved in /var/lib/zuul/builds/6b4b4a7956ab4e938423213f455e42e2/work/6b4b4a7956ab4e938423213f455e42e2_id_rsa 2026-03-07 18:53:20.033176 | noble -> localhost | Your public key has been saved in /var/lib/zuul/builds/6b4b4a7956ab4e938423213f455e42e2/work/6b4b4a7956ab4e938423213f455e42e2_id_rsa.pub 2026-03-07 18:53:20.033204 | noble -> localhost | The key fingerprint is: 2026-03-07 18:53:20.033229 | noble -> localhost | SHA256:yWlM3Ssf0GEaFKcy5cwCPmQ6ZE6dJKQ3cb7zw2IZUWI zuul-build-sshkey 2026-03-07 18:53:20.033252 | noble -> localhost | The key's randomart image is: 2026-03-07 18:53:20.033274 | noble -> localhost | +---[RSA 3072]----+ 2026-03-07 18:53:20.033295 | noble -> localhost | | .BoE...=.+ | 2026-03-07 18:53:20.033331 | noble -> localhost | | * @o+ * O . | 2026-03-07 18:53:20.033376 | noble -> localhost | | . * = = O o | 2026-03-07 18:53:20.033398 | noble -> localhost | | . o B * . . | 2026-03-07 18:53:20.033419 | noble -> localhost | | + S . o | 2026-03-07 18:53:20.033449 | noble -> localhost | | B o . | 2026-03-07 18:53:20.033469 | noble -> localhost | | + + . | 2026-03-07 18:53:20.033489 | noble -> localhost | | . . . | 2026-03-07 18:53:20.033509 | noble -> localhost | | | 2026-03-07 18:53:20.033530 | noble -> localhost | +----[SHA256]-----+ 2026-03-07 18:53:20.033586 | noble -> localhost | ok: Runtime: 0:00:01.250441 2026-03-07 18:53:20.042711 | 2026-03-07 18:53:20.042868 | TASK [add-build-sshkey : Remote setup ssh keys (linux)] 2026-03-07 18:53:20.083813 | noble | ok 2026-03-07 18:53:20.094454 | noble | included: /var/lib/zuul/builds/6b4b4a7956ab4e938423213f455e42e2/trusted/project_1/github.com/osism/openinfra-zuul-jobs/roles/add-build-sshkey/tasks/remote-linux.yaml 2026-03-07 18:53:20.104892 | 2026-03-07 18:53:20.105014 | TASK [add-build-sshkey : Remove previously added zuul-build-sshkey] 2026-03-07 18:53:20.129976 | noble | skipping: Conditional result was False 2026-03-07 18:53:20.138784 | 2026-03-07 18:53:20.138927 | TASK [add-build-sshkey : Enable access via build key on all nodes] 2026-03-07 18:53:20.773669 | noble | changed 2026-03-07 18:53:20.780634 | 2026-03-07 18:53:20.780741 | TASK [add-build-sshkey : Make sure user has a .ssh] 2026-03-07 18:53:21.080439 | noble | ok 2026-03-07 18:53:21.088731 | 2026-03-07 18:53:21.088857 | TASK [add-build-sshkey : Install build private key as SSH key on all nodes] 2026-03-07 18:53:21.849989 | noble | changed 2026-03-07 18:53:21.858451 | 2026-03-07 18:53:21.858588 | TASK [add-build-sshkey : Install build public key as SSH key on all nodes] 2026-03-07 18:53:22.639535 | noble | changed 2026-03-07 18:53:22.646206 | 2026-03-07 18:53:22.646322 | TASK [add-build-sshkey : Remote setup ssh keys (windows)] 2026-03-07 18:53:22.680032 | noble | skipping: Conditional result was False 2026-03-07 18:53:22.686934 | 2026-03-07 18:53:22.687041 | TASK [remove-zuul-sshkey : Remove master key from local agent] 2026-03-07 18:53:23.137802 | noble -> localhost | changed 2026-03-07 18:53:23.158628 | 2026-03-07 18:53:23.158770 | TASK [add-build-sshkey : Add back temp key] 2026-03-07 18:53:23.537814 | noble -> localhost | Identity added: /var/lib/zuul/builds/6b4b4a7956ab4e938423213f455e42e2/work/6b4b4a7956ab4e938423213f455e42e2_id_rsa (zuul-build-sshkey) 2026-03-07 18:53:23.538084 | noble -> localhost | ok: Runtime: 0:00:00.019813 2026-03-07 18:53:23.545817 | 2026-03-07 18:53:23.545939 | TASK [add-build-sshkey : Verify we can still SSH to all nodes] 2026-03-07 18:53:24.000921 | noble | ok 2026-03-07 18:53:24.007047 | 2026-03-07 18:53:24.007154 | TASK [add-build-sshkey : Verify we can still SSH to all nodes (windows)] 2026-03-07 18:53:24.030705 | noble | skipping: Conditional result was False 2026-03-07 18:53:24.081189 | 2026-03-07 18:53:24.081327 | TASK [start-zuul-console : Start zuul_console daemon.] 2026-03-07 18:53:24.524426 | noble | ok 2026-03-07 18:53:24.540672 | 2026-03-07 18:53:24.540825 | TASK [validate-host : Define zuul_info_dir fact] 2026-03-07 18:53:24.574596 | noble | ok 2026-03-07 18:53:24.583512 | 2026-03-07 18:53:24.583635 | TASK [validate-host : Ensure Zuul Ansible directory exists] 2026-03-07 18:53:24.891163 | noble -> localhost | ok 2026-03-07 18:53:24.898858 | 2026-03-07 18:53:24.898987 | TASK [validate-host : Collect information about the host] 2026-03-07 18:53:26.331052 | noble | ok 2026-03-07 18:53:26.345176 | 2026-03-07 18:53:26.345312 | TASK [validate-host : Sanitize hostname] 2026-03-07 18:53:26.410934 | noble | ok 2026-03-07 18:53:26.419928 | 2026-03-07 18:53:26.420096 | TASK [validate-host : Write out all ansible variables/facts known for each host] 2026-03-07 18:53:27.011521 | noble -> localhost | changed 2026-03-07 18:53:27.018535 | 2026-03-07 18:53:27.018662 | TASK [validate-host : Collect information about zuul worker] 2026-03-07 18:53:27.500290 | noble | ok 2026-03-07 18:53:27.508596 | 2026-03-07 18:53:27.508745 | TASK [validate-host : Write out all zuul information for each host] 2026-03-07 18:53:28.070158 | noble -> localhost | changed 2026-03-07 18:53:28.080875 | 2026-03-07 18:53:28.080982 | TASK [prepare-workspace-log : Start zuul_console daemon.] 2026-03-07 18:53:28.390050 | noble | ok 2026-03-07 18:53:28.399205 | 2026-03-07 18:53:28.399329 | TASK [prepare-workspace-log : Synchronize src repos to workspace directory.] 2026-03-07 18:53:29.393053 | noble | changed: 2026-03-07 18:53:29.393323 | noble | cd+++++++++ src/ 2026-03-07 18:53:29.393423 | noble | cd+++++++++ src/github.com/ 2026-03-07 18:53:29.393463 | noble | cd+++++++++ src/github.com/osism/ 2026-03-07 18:53:29.393496 | noble | cd+++++++++ src/github.com/osism/openstack-ironic-images/ 2026-03-07 18:53:29.393526 | noble | localhost | ok: "/var/lib/zuul/builds/6b4b4a7956ab4e938423213f455e42e2/work/logs" 2026-03-07 19:02:09.410623 | noble -> localhost | changed: "/var/lib/zuul/builds/6b4b4a7956ab4e938423213f455e42e2/work/artifacts" 2026-03-07 19:02:09.689233 | noble -> localhost | changed: "/var/lib/zuul/builds/6b4b4a7956ab4e938423213f455e42e2/work/docs" 2026-03-07 19:02:09.715233 | 2026-03-07 19:02:09.715387 | LOOP [fetch-output : Collect logs, artifacts and docs] 2026-03-07 19:02:11.064088 | noble | changed: 2026-03-07 19:02:11.064503 | noble | .d..t...... ./ 2026-03-07 19:02:11.064592 | noble | >f+++++++++ osism-ipa.log 2026-03-07 19:02:11.064702 | noble | changed: All items complete 2026-03-07 19:02:11.064778 | 2026-03-07 19:02:11.739059 | noble | changed: .d..t...... ./ 2026-03-07 19:02:12.427670 | noble | changed: .d..t...... ./ 2026-03-07 19:02:12.454189 | 2026-03-07 19:02:12.454360 | LOOP [merge-output-to-logs : Move artifacts and docs to logs dir] 2026-03-07 19:02:12.491883 | noble | skipping: Conditional result was False 2026-03-07 19:02:12.494349 | noble | skipping: Conditional result was False 2026-03-07 19:02:12.513186 | 2026-03-07 19:02:12.513305 | PLAY RECAP 2026-03-07 19:02:12.513385 | noble | ok: 3 changed: 2 unreachable: 0 failed: 0 skipped: 2 rescued: 0 ignored: 0 2026-03-07 19:02:12.513425 | 2026-03-07 19:02:12.641474 | POST-RUN END RESULT_NORMAL: [trusted : github.com/osism/zuul-config/playbooks/base/post-fetch.yaml@main] 2026-03-07 19:02:12.644459 | POST-RUN START: [trusted : github.com/osism/zuul-config/playbooks/base/post.yaml@main] 2026-03-07 19:02:13.385251 | 2026-03-07 19:02:13.385413 | PLAY [Base post] 2026-03-07 19:02:13.400589 | 2026-03-07 19:02:13.400736 | TASK [remove-build-sshkey : Remove the build SSH key from all nodes] 2026-03-07 19:02:14.072234 | noble | changed 2026-03-07 19:02:14.082994 | 2026-03-07 19:02:14.083143 | PLAY RECAP 2026-03-07 19:02:14.083247 | noble | ok: 1 changed: 1 unreachable: 0 failed: 0 skipped: 0 rescued: 0 ignored: 0 2026-03-07 19:02:14.083332 | 2026-03-07 19:02:14.204502 | POST-RUN END RESULT_NORMAL: [trusted : github.com/osism/zuul-config/playbooks/base/post.yaml@main] 2026-03-07 19:02:14.205521 | POST-RUN START: [trusted : github.com/osism/zuul-config/playbooks/base/post-logs.yaml@main] 2026-03-07 19:02:15.009057 | 2026-03-07 19:02:15.009241 | PLAY [Base post-logs] 2026-03-07 19:02:15.020587 | 2026-03-07 19:02:15.020735 | TASK [generate-zuul-manifest : Generate Zuul manifest] 2026-03-07 19:02:15.496274 | localhost | changed 2026-03-07 19:02:15.510769 | 2026-03-07 19:02:15.511007 | TASK [generate-zuul-manifest : Return Zuul manifest URL to Zuul] 2026-03-07 19:02:15.539776 | localhost | ok 2026-03-07 19:02:15.545839 | 2026-03-07 19:02:15.546003 | TASK [Set zuul-log-path fact] 2026-03-07 19:02:15.574968 | localhost | ok 2026-03-07 19:02:15.590555 | 2026-03-07 19:02:15.590732 | TASK [set-zuul-log-path-fact : Set log path for a build] 2026-03-07 19:02:15.628344 | localhost | ok 2026-03-07 19:02:15.631684 | 2026-03-07 19:02:15.631799 | TASK [upload-logs : Create log directories] 2026-03-07 19:02:16.142291 | localhost | changed 2026-03-07 19:02:16.147787 | 2026-03-07 19:02:16.147949 | TASK [upload-logs : Ensure logs are readable before uploading] 2026-03-07 19:02:16.660655 | localhost -> localhost | ok: Runtime: 0:00:00.007566 2026-03-07 19:02:16.669523 | 2026-03-07 19:02:16.669746 | TASK [upload-logs : Upload logs to log server] 2026-03-07 19:02:17.264330 | localhost | Output suppressed because no_log was given 2026-03-07 19:02:17.266272 | 2026-03-07 19:02:17.266379 | LOOP [upload-logs : Compress console log and json output] 2026-03-07 19:02:17.327398 | localhost | skipping: Conditional result was False 2026-03-07 19:02:17.332272 | localhost | skipping: Conditional result was False 2026-03-07 19:02:17.343620 | 2026-03-07 19:02:17.343751 | LOOP [upload-logs : Upload compressed console log and json output] 2026-03-07 19:02:17.402293 | localhost | skipping: Conditional result was False 2026-03-07 19:02:17.403088 | 2026-03-07 19:02:17.406553 | localhost | skipping: Conditional result was False 2026-03-07 19:02:17.414028 | 2026-03-07 19:02:17.414236 | LOOP [upload-logs : Upload console log and json output]